Nginx Performance Tuning: A Step-by-Step Approach
Optimizing Nginx's performance can substantially improve website page times and overall user experience. This article presents a actionable step-by-step process for fine-tuning Nginx. Firstly, analyze your current configuration using utilities like Nginx's built-in status interfaces. Then, evaluate adjusting worker limits ; increasing the `worker_processes` number to match the number of CPU cores and the `worker_connections` value to suit expected traffic . Next, use efficient caching techniques , including HTTP caching and reverse proxy caching. Finally, regularly observe your server's CPU utilization and perform necessary adjustments based on the data.
